Bernard E. "Buddy" Pacy, Jr., 69, of Erie, passed away on September 15, 2025. He was born in Erie on April 13, 1956, a son of the late, Bernard E. Sr. and Terra (Malone) Pacy.

Buddy was known in recent years as Erie's longest-performing semi-retired drag queen, lived a life full of creativity, style, and friendship.

Buddy's love for the arts began shortly after high school, where he immersed himself in theater and performance. He was involved in numerous productions, including Studio 219 under the direction of Lucien Zombronmy, the National Playwright Showcase at Mercyhurst College, and The Roadhouse Theater. He also graced the stage at PACA on State Street, sharing his passion and talent with Erie audiences.

During his time in New York City, Buddy worked with Macy's and Chanel, blending his flair for fashion with his professional pursuits. A licensed cosmetologist, he co-owned the local hair salon Eugene Charles and also worked in several salons in Manhattan. Upon returning to Erie, Buddy continued his career by running his own salon from the basement of his home, proudly using the motto on his business cards: "Beauty is my life."

Above all, Buddy will be remembered for his vibrant personality, his loyalty as a friend, and his ability to make people feel special.

He is survived by his partner, Richard Quinlan; his son, Aaron Pacy and his family; as well as extended family members and countless friends who will miss him dearly. In addition to his parents, Buddy is preceded in death by his older brother, Timothy Pacy.
